Details

Launched in 2018, the "Lease Rental Subsidy Scheme" is one of the "Information Technology Policy Schemes" by the Department of Information Technology, Government of Goa. The objective and the scope of this scheme is to provide Lease Rental Subsidy to the eligible Information Technology Units in the State of Goa. All the New and Existing Units having their operations in Goa are eligible. The scheme has been framed as a part of Goa's IT Policy that envisages Goa as an aspirational geographical and human resource base for IT Units and a preferred destination for their investment and expansion.

Benefits

  • 1. A rental/ Lease reimbursement on the built-up office space lease/rent, up to 50% of the Annual Lease Rentals (60% in cases where 30% or more of the employees are women) for a period of 2 years. 2. Incentives under clause 2.1 above shall be disbursed on a pro-rata basis based on the number of Employees of Goan origin or Goan Graduates:
  • Upto 30% of employees on rolls of the company: 50%
  • 30% to 60% employees on rolls of the company: 75%
  • More than 60%employees on rolls of the company: 100% In order to avail the benefits of the scheme, the employees should be on the rolls of the company for a minimum period of one year. 3. The above rebate is also applicable if the built-up space is leased from GIDC/ any Government Agency. 4. For the units availing land from GIDC/ any Government Agency, a reimbursement of the upfront lease premium (as per the Stamp Registration) paid by the unit shall be reimbursed as per the payment to the Allotment Agency. In addition, the annual lease rentals paid to the allotment can also be claimed post-completion of one year of operation. This reimbursement would be provided for a period of 2 years. 5. In order to avail of this benefit the unit should be operational for at least one year prior to the date of applying for the incentive. 6. The Maximum benefit under this scheme for smaller business units would be ₹10,00,000. 7. There is no cap for the Mega & Other Business Units under this Scheme. NOTE 1: The benefits under this scheme are subject to budgetary allocation. No Promissory Estoppel shall be applicable if benefits are discontinued in case the allocation is exceeded. NOTE 2: The applicant units will be subject to evaluation at the end of the Fiscal Year to verify eligibility for continuing to receive a subsidy under this scheme

Eligibility

  1. The applicant should be a New or an Existing Unit.
  2. The applicant must have their operations in Goa.
  3. The applicant must be one of the following:
  • Proprietorship Firm
  • Private Limited Company incorporated under the Companies Act, 2013 (or equivalent)
  • Public Limited Company incorporated under the Companies Act, 2013 (or equivalent)
  • Registered Partnership Firm incorporated under the Indian Partnership Act, 1932 (or equivalent)
  • Limited Liability Partnership incorporated under Limited Liability Partnership Act, 2008 (or equivalent)
  1. The bank accounts of the unit and/or its partner(s)/director(s) should be linked to Aadhaar.
    NOTE: Only the expenses incurred after the notification of this policy will be eligible for a lease rental rebate subsidy.

Exclusions

The Units availing similar financial incentives under any other policy of the Government of Goa are not eligible.

Application Process

Online

Step 1: Visit the Official Web Portal of Goa Online. At the top right corner, click "Register".
Step 2: On the next page, verify your Email ID and Mobile Number using OTP. You will be redirected to the Registration Page.
Step 3: On the Registration Page, fill in all the mandatory fields of the registration form. Create a Login Name and a strong Password. Carefully read the Declaration and the Terms & Conditions, and tick the checkboxes. Fill in the Captcha Code, and click "Register/Signup".
Step 4: Login to the website using your Login Name and Password. Fill in the Captcha Code, and click "Login".
Step 5: In the top ribbon, click on "Services", then click on "IT Services". Click on the name of the scheme. You will be taken to the application form for the scheme. Fill in all the mandatory fields and upload all the mandatory documents.
Step 6: Submit the application. A unique registration number will be generated. Note this number for future reference.
NOTE: The applicant can apply for this scheme on a quarterly/bi-annually/annual basis after incurring the relevant expenditure.

Disbursement Timeline

  • Incentive Application Receipt: D
  • Application scrutiny as per checklist: D+30days
  • Application approval by the Empowered Committee: D+60 days
  • Issue of Regret Letter/Sanction Orders and Disbursement: D+90 days

NOTE: Units will be subject to evaluation at the end of each installment period to verify eligibility for the next installment.
